Find Out More About Octagonfind.com: A Dubious Search Engine You Should Avoid

What Is Octagonfind.com?

Octagonfind.com presents itself as a search engine, but in reality, it lacks the functionality of a legitimate search provider. Instead, it operates as a gateway to other search engines, such as Bing, by redirecting users' queries. Users who find their browsers automatically loading Octagonfind.com likely have an intrusive extension called Octagon Find installed. This extension modifies browser settings to force users to interact with the questionable search page.

How Browser Hijackers Manipulate Browsing Preferences

Browser hijackers like Octagon Find are designed to alter essential browser settings, making it difficult for users to undo the changes. Once installed, this extension assigns Octagonfind.com as the default homepage, search engine, and new tab page. As a result, every browsing session begins with an interaction with this site, often without the user's consent.

Why Octagonfind.com Raises Privacy Concerns

One of the more concerning aspects of the Octagon Find extension is its ability to read and modify user data on Octagonfind.com and other sites. This means it could potentially monitor browsing activity, manipulate displayed content, or interfere with how users interact with certain web pages. Such behavior introduces privacy risks and could make users more vulnerable to intrusive tracking or exposure to misleading content.

How Users Unknowingly Install Browser Hijackers

Many users install browser hijackers on their devices without realizing it. This often happens through software bundling, a method where unwanted extensions or programs are packaged alongside free applications. If users do not carefully review installation settings, they may inadvertently allow these extra components onto their system.

Other Distribution Methods of Questionable Extensions

Besides bundling, browser hijackers may also spread through deceptive online advertisements, misleading pop-ups, and fake software updates. Some users might be tricked into installing an unwanted extension by visiting a compromised or untrustworthy website that aggressively pushes installation prompts.

Preventing Unwanted Browser Changes

To avoid dealing with intrusive browser extensions, users should be cautious when installing new software or extensions. Always choose reputable sources for downloads, such as official websites or trusted app stores. Additionally, reviewing installation settings and opting for "Custom" or "Advanced" setup options can help identify and decline any unnecessary add-ons.
